Supply decreased this week, causing pork prices to increase further to 15 yuan per kilogram.
According to the monitoring of the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Affairs, on July 4th, the average price of pork in national agricultural wholesale markets was 20.58 yuan/kg, a 1.7% increase from the 20.23 yuan/kg on last Friday. This week's average price was 20.38 yuan/kg, a 0.7% increase from last week's average of 20.23 yuan/kg. Domestic pork prices continued to rise this week, with a week-on-week increase in average price. According to data from China's pig farming website, on July 4th, the price of live pigs was 15.31 yuan/kg, a 5.1% increase from the 14.57 yuan/kg on last Friday. In terms of the average price for the week, this week's average price for live pigs was 15.1 yuan/kg, a 4.4% increase from last week's average of 14.46 yuan/kg.
